摘 要:为解决生物降解材料使用过程中容易被腐蚀、使用寿命短等问题,研究以生物降解基Zntrs复合材料为例,通过抗菌剂的添加,与高分子材料聚乳酸(PLA)、聚丁二酸丁二醇酯(PBS)熔融共混加工,制备了生物可降解材料,实践证实其能够对大肠杆菌产生良好的抑制,抗菌作用强,拥有广阔的发展前景。
关键词:生物降解材料;制备;抗菌性能;贴膜法;平板培养基法

Abstract:In order to solve the problems of easy corrosion and short service life of biodegradable materials during use,the study took biodegradable Zntrs composite materials as an example through the addition of antibacterial agents,melt blending with polymer materials PLA and PBS to prepare biodegradable materials.Practice has proved that it can produce good inhibition to E.coli,has strong antibacterial effect,and has broad development prospects.
Key words:biodegradable materials;preparation;antibacterial properties;film method;plate culture method
